An amendment to make technical changes to a provision in the bill which requires that federal highway grants to individual states be reduced by 2% annually unless the state enacts laws requiring that the drivers licenses of persons convicted of selling or using drugs be automatically suspended for at least six months.

Purpose
Amendment makes technical corrections to the FY 1991 Transportation Appropriations Act and requires the Secretary of Transportation to withhold annually two percent of the Federal highway funds provided to those States that do not enact legislation requiring the automatic suspension for at least six months of the drivers' licenses of individuals convicted of drug offenses.
